Output 683214500c666a0e1ebb3e81d20cf62c2e09ee5b64efcf04ecb836ac823023e9:1

value
12046402
script pubkey
OP_0 OP_PUSHBYTES_20 37f39d5e3b55fead2cbf8205b7f68abb0a61864b
address
ltc1qxlee6h3m2hl26t9lsgzm0a52hv9xrpjt2xt0c2
transaction
683214500c666a0e1ebb3e81d20cf62c2e09ee5b64efcf04ecb836ac823023e9
spent
true